你查询的IP:[159.226.77.102]  地理位置:中国–北京–北京科技网

最新查询124.20.1.191 159.226.31.8 117.24.207.171 220.231.53.125 121.192.196.77 123.52.3.194 58.116.140.101 117.8.20.68 114.68.245.183 159.226.77.102 221.13.146.11 220.160.168.59 121.76.189.13 61.87.192.15 202.4.252.78 117.121.192.215 222.125.86.149 61.8.160.26 117.124.164.213 58.68.128.127 198.17.7.216 123.206.118.124 117.124.160.245 119.128.5.191 116.198.112.130 123.49.128.192 202.181.112.97 210.14.128.120 202.63.248.134 59.107.223.9 202.69.16.65